原文:让JPA的Query查询接口返回Map对象

在JPA . 中我们可以使用entityManager.createNativeQuery 来执行原生的SQL语句。 但当我们查询结果没有对应实体类时,query.getResultList 返回的是一个List lt Object gt 。也就是说每行的数据被作为一个对象数组返回。 常见的用法是这样的: public void testNativeQuery Query query entity ...

2017-12-29 15:44 0 2365 推荐指数:

查看详情

设置JPAQuery返回Map对象

说明正常执行jpa查询的时候需要传一个对应实体进行映射返回的数据,这样有时候如果一个sql是复合sql关联很多表,就需要新建实体有点麻烦,通过下面方式就能将返回结果映射成map。这样就能随意获取返回结果的内容 Query query ...

Fri Jul 20 00:22:00 CST 2018 0 3687
【转】让EntityManager的Query返回Map对象

  在JPA 2.0中我们可以使用entityManager.createNativeQuery()来执行原生的SQL语句。但当我们查询结果没有对应实体类时,需使用entityManager.createNativeQuery(String sqlString)来执行查询时 ...

Wed Apr 24 02:51:00 CST 2019 0 2472
MySQL 合并查询,以map对象的形式返回

转载 CSDN博主「小林子林子」 -> https://blog.csdn.net/qq_26106607/article/details/84961254 原始SQL-> 目的-> 合并查询 初次转换: 结果: ---> 不符合预期 : 以MAP或者对象 ...

Tue Nov 12 19:18:00 CST 2019 0 608
jpa jpql @query 动态查询

需求/背景 实现 分析 使用sql编写技巧实现动态查询 TOC 需求/背景 用户表对应的用户实体: 前端需要实现这样的查询: 其中部门支持多选; 实现 分析 jpa里的复杂查询一般使用@Query完成, 但是@Query并不支持动态过滤 ...

Wed Jul 01 21:47:00 CST 2020 0 2330
Spring Data Jpa 查询返回自定义对象

转载请注明出处:http://www.wangyongkui.com/java-jpa-query。 今天使用Jpa遇到一个问题,发现查询多个字段时返回对象不能自动转换成自定义对象。代码如下: 好了,这回查询直接返回的就是UserDto对象了。 ...

Tue Apr 26 10:24:00 CST 2016 3 13047
spring data jpa 利用@Query进行查询

介绍@Query注释之前,先看看怎么利用@NamedQuery进行命名查询 1.现在实体类上定义方法已经具体查询语句 2.然后我们继承接口之后,就可以直接用这个方法了,它会执行我们定义好的查询语句并返回结果 试想一下,如果我们想自己定义执行查询,利用 ...

Wed Apr 17 00:23:00 CST 2019 0 14822
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M